Aggregate performance score
We've compared GeForce GTX 1070 Ti and GeForce GTX 1650, covering specs and all relevant benchmarks.
GeForce GTX 1070 Ti outperforms GeForce GTX 1650 by a significant 93% based on our aggregate benchmark results.
Summary
We compared two graphics cards: the GeForce GTX 1070 Ti with 8GB VRAM (Pascal architecture), against the GeForce GTX 1650 with 4GB VRAM (Turing architecture). The GeForce GTX 1070 Ti offers significantly better value for money with a 37% higher value score. The GeForce GTX 1650 is more power-efficient, consuming 75W compared to 180W. Technical Specifications
Side-by-side hardware comparison
Specification | GeForce GTX 1070 Ti | GeForce GTX 1650 |
---|---|---|
Architecture | Pascal | Turing |
VRAM Size | 8 GB | 4 GB |
TDP | 180W | 75W |
